School-Based Grant Opportunities
The MCSC distributes a Request for Proposals (RFP) that enables school districts to apply for grant funds to develop sustainable high quality service-learning initiatives. The ultimate goal of funding is to assist applicants in establishing sequential service-learning opportunities so that at a minimum all students will have at least one service-learning experience at the elementary, middle, and high school levels. In order to meet the varying needs of school districts three types of grants are available: Planning, Implementation, and Institutionalization. The MCSC funds planning grants to school districts that have never received Learn and Serve - Michigan funding to enable them to incorporate service-learning throughout the district. Implementation grants are provided to expand and sustain the practice of quality service-learning throughout the district. Institutionalization grants are provided to enable districts to sustain quality service-learning practice.
